The nation's top environmental official and several governors from the Chesapeake Bay watershed are gathering to size up progress in the restoration of the bay.
The Chesapeake Executive Council is convening for its annual meeting today in Richmond. Among the scheduled speakers are Environmental Protection Agency chief Lisa Jackson, Virginia Gov. Bob McDonnell and his counterpart from Maryland, Martin O'Malley. Pennsylvania Gov. Tom Corbett and District of Columbia Mayor Vincent Gray are also expected.
The bay's Executive Council establishes the policy agenda for the Chesapeake Bay Program. The bay is the focus of a massive restoration effort led by the EPA and involving all six states in its 64,000-square-mile watershed.
The other states include New York, Delaware and West Virginia.
